Description
West Africa, Ghana, Akan peoples, Asante or Ashanti culture 20th century. Large and impressive example of a rare feline Leopard sword fitting, the leopard in the standing position with mouth closed and tail upturned. Strong symbol of Akan royal power in one of the most important symbols of royal imagery the (Leopard) worn at the top of a sword sheath in the royal court.Size 10 1/2" L x 3" W
